Size: a a a

Django [ru] #STAY HOME

2020 August 18

A

Aquinary in Django [ru] #STAY HOME
Немного не понимаю вот этого момента. При добавлении новой модели с нуля при auto_now_add и auto_now не просит указать что-то там по умолчанию. Однако если проводятся некоторые манипуляции с этим полем (не искал закономерностей, но периодически такое бывает), то требует чтобы я ему умолчание задал.
Почему именно так?
источник

AS

Alexander Shakhmatov in Django [ru] #STAY HOME
Потому что поля до этого не было, а записи в базе уже есть, для которых оно добавляется?
источник

AG

Artem Gubatenko in Django [ru] #STAY HOME
Aquinary
Немного не понимаю вот этого момента. При добавлении новой модели с нуля при auto_now_add и auto_now не просит указать что-то там по умолчанию. Однако если проводятся некоторые манипуляции с этим полем (не искал закономерностей, но периодически такое бывает), то требует чтобы я ему умолчание задал.
Почему именно так?
auto_now_add и auto_now  - срабатывают при добавлении/изменении записей, а когда записи уже есть - надо указать что им вписать
источник

A

Aquinary in Django [ru] #STAY HOME
А могу ли я в ручную применить часть миграции внутри файла?
(не уверен, что вынести это в отдельный файл будет хорошей идеей)
источник

AG

Artem Gubatenko in Django [ru] #STAY HOME
Aquinary
А могу ли я в ручную применить часть миграции внутри файла?
(не уверен, что вынести это в отдельный файл будет хорошей идеей)
разбить создание таблицы на части? - можешь
источник

A

Aquinary in Django [ru] #STAY HOME
Aquinary
А могу ли я в ручную применить часть миграции внутри файла?
(не уверен, что вынести это в отдельный файл будет хорошей идеей)
В общем то уже не нужно.
(Появляется глубокая уверенность, что среди тестовых заданий при собеседовании должна присутствовать задача на решение таких вот проблем с миграциями. И градации решения: снёс всю базу, снёс только таблицу, всё сделал без порчи данных)
источник

A

Aquinary in Django [ru] #STAY HOME
Artem Gubatenko
разбить создание таблицы на части? - можешь
Удалось и без этого, просто снова миграции похерились и не хотелось всю бд сносить из-за этого)
источник

A

Andrey in Django [ru] #STAY HOME
Artem Gubatenko
По-моему, шаблонизатор отловит IndexError и исключения не будет)
Вот тут уточнять надо
Я давно не рендерил ничего
источник

AG

Artem Gubatenko in Django [ru] #STAY HOME
Andrey
Вот тут уточнять надо
Я давно не рендерил ничего
проверил на пустом списке - отлавливает
источник

A

Andrey in Django [ru] #STAY HOME
Artem Gubatenko
проверил на пустом списке - отлавливает
Он просто этот блок не рендерит в итоге?
источник

A

Andrey in Django [ru] #STAY HOME
Блок с исключением*
источник

AG

Artem Gubatenko in Django [ru] #STAY HOME
Andrey
Он просто этот блок не рендерит в итоге?
test == {{ test.2 }} вывел только test ==
источник
2020 August 19

M

Malik in Django [ru] #STAY HOME
Здравствуйте! помогите пожалуйста , я использую django.contrib.auth.models User , в поле регистраций все поля выводятся .Для детального просмотра только те который django.contrib.auth.models User есть по умолчанию ,через context_object_name выводит в шаблоне только по умолчанию поля User, остальных полей нет, как можно вывести остальные прописаны мною поля ? подскажите пожалуйста
источник

GK

Grysha K in Django [ru] #STAY HOME
Ребята, посоветуйте какие нибудь источники для того чтоб выучить Django
источник

K

Kirito in Django [ru] #STAY HOME
Grysha K
Ребята, посоветуйте какие нибудь источники для того чтоб выучить Django
источник

GK

Grysha K in Django [ru] #STAY HOME
По документации?
источник

GK

Grysha K in Django [ru] #STAY HOME
Серьезно 😂😂😂
источник

K

Kirito in Django [ru] #STAY HOME
Ну для начала😁
источник

K

Kirito in Django [ru] #STAY HOME
Ладно если серьезно я вот читаю сейчас
источник

K

Kirito in Django [ru] #STAY HOME
источник